A note on a family of quadrature formulas and some applications
(2008) Bożek, Bogusław; Solak, Wiesław; Szydełko, Zbigniew
In this paper a construction of a one-parameter family of quadrature formulas is presented. This family contains the classical quadrature formulas: trapezoidal rule, mid-point rule and two-point Gauss rule. One can prove that for any continuous function there exists a parameter for which the value of quadrature formula is equal to the integral. Some applications of this family to the construction of cubature formulas, numerical solution of ordinary differential equations and integral equations are presented.
On a complete lattice of retracts of a free monoid generated by three elements
(2008) Foryś, Wit
We prove that the family of retracts of a free monoid generated by three elements, partially ordered with respect to the inclusion, is a complete lattice.

A first-order spectral phase transition in a class of periodically modulated Hermitian Jacobi matrices
(2008) Pchelintseva, Irina
We consider self-adjoint unbounded Jacobi matrices with diagonal $q_n = b_{n}n$ and off-diagonal entries $\lambda_n = n$, where bn is a $2$-periodical sequence of real numbers. The parameter space is decomposed into several separate regions, where the spectrum of the operator is either purely absolutely continuous or discrete. We study the situation where the spectral phase transition occurs, namely the case of $b_{1}b_{2} = 4$. The main motive of the paper is the investigation of asymptotics of generalized eigenvectors of the Jacobi matrix. The pure point part of the spectrum is analyzed in detail.
On a multivalued second order differential problem with Hukuhara derivative
(2008) Piszczek, Magdalena
Let $K$ be a closed convex cone with the nonempty interior in a real Banach space and let $cc(K)$ denote the family of all nonempty convex compact subsets of $K$. Assume that continuous linear multifunctions $H,\Psi : K \to cc(K)$ are given. We consider the following problem $\begin{aligned}D^2\Phi(t,x) =& \Phi(t,H(x)), D\Phi(t,x)|_{t=0} =& \{0\}, \Phi(0,x) =& \Psi(x)\end{aligned}$ for $t \geq 0$ and $x \in K$, where $D\Phi(t,x)$ denotes the Hukuhara derivative of $\Phi(t,x)$ with respect to $t$.
